scanf_main(Reader * reader,const char * __restrict str,internal::ArgList & args)23 int scanf_main(Reader *reader, const char *__restrict str,
24                internal::ArgList &args) {
25   Parser<internal::ArgList> parser(str, args);
26   int ret_val = READ_OK;
27   int conversions = 0;
28   for (FormatSection cur_section = parser.get_next_section();
29        !cur_section.raw_string.empty() && ret_val == READ_OK;
30        cur_section = parser.get_next_section()) {
31     if (cur_section.has_conv) {
32       ret_val = convert(reader, cur_section);
33       // The %n (current position) conversion doesn't increment the number of
34       // assignments.
35       if (cur_section.conv_name != 'n')
36         conversions += ret_val == READ_OK ? 1 : 0;
37     } else {
38       ret_val = raw_match(reader, cur_section.raw_string);
39     }
40   }
41 
42   return conversions;
43 }
